However, I suspect that very few significant others will find it amusing, so use with caution. A thin connecting part joins the body to the heads. This is an unintentional design anomaly that ended up working in my favor, so I left it in - but it's not meant for printing. To simplify assembly, print the "NO" first and when the figure is complete, glue the "NO" onto the figure before removing it from the print bed. Only the kids' heads need to be glued; everything else stays put. I'm still experimenting with tape. The clear 3M mounting tape in the picture is quite gooey and tricky to work with - I think a better option would be the clear tape used for 3M shrink wrap winter window coverings.
